Why Live in The Fan

The Fan neighborhood in Richmond, Virginia, is a historic area influenced by the City Beautiful movement, characterized by its orderly architectural designs and public green spaces. Monument Avenue, with its grassy medians and historic mansions, is a notable feature, though it has a complex history tied to Confederate statues, which were removed in 2021. The neighborhood offers a variety of dining options, with local favorites like Joe’s Inn, Kuba Kuba, and Bacchus lining Main and Cary streets. Shopping is convenient with nearby Carytown providing grocery stores and boutique shops. For medical needs, residents have access to the Retreat Doctor’s Hospital within the neighborhood and VCU Medical Center about 2 miles away. The Fan is home to several parks, including Monroe Park, Scuffletown Park, and Meadow Park, all within walking distance for residents. The area also supports a vibrant arts scene, with local galleries, murals, and venues like The Altria and The Camel hosting performances. The Virginia Museum of Fine Arts and the Virginia Museum of History and Culture are nearby cultural landmarks. The Fan District Association organizes community events such as the Holiday House Tour and the Kitchen and Garden Tour. The neighborhood is zoned for Richmond Public Schools, with students attending William Fox Elementary, currently relocated to Clark Springs Elementary, and the highly rated Maggie L. Walker Governor’s School for Government and International Studies. Homes in The Fan range from Queen Annes to Craftsman-style properties, creating a cohesive yet unique streetscape.
